WHITE CHOCOLATE CRANBERRY GRANOLA BARS
GREAT “Healthy” Snack!
ingredients
- 1/4 cup sugar
- 1/4 cup maple syrup
- 1/4 cup honey
- 2 Tbs reduced fat peanut butter
- 1 egg white
- 1 Tbs fat-free evaporated milk
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 1 cup whole wheat flour
- 1/2 tsp baking soda
- 1/2 tsp ground cinnamon
- 1/4 tsp ground allspice
- 2 cups old-fashioned oats
- 1 1/2 cups crisp rice cereal
- 1/3 cup vanilla or white chips
- 1/4 cup dried cranberries
- 1/4 cup chopped walnuts
directions
- 1
1. In a large bowl, combine the first seven ingredients; mix well. Separately, combine the flour, baking soda, cinnamon and allspice; add to the sugar mixture. Stir in the remaining ingredients.
- 2
2. Press into a 13x9x2 inch baking pan coated with nonstick cooking spray. Bake @ 350 degrees (F) for 18-20 minutes or until golden brown. Score the surface with shallow cuts, making rectangular bars. Cool completely on a wire rack. Cut along score lines.
